Modeling a plethora of dimerized phases in IrTe<sub>2</sub>

Abstract

IrTe2 is a one of the transition metal dichalcogenides with the structure containing triple triangular layers Te-Ir-Te with Ir ions in the octahedral coordination. Upon cooling below 220 K a sequence of phases with rows of Ir-Ir dimers are seen. Here we combine first principles calculations and a simplified model descibing the free energy of dimerized phases to compute the phase diagram and rationalize the emergence of these phases.
